As github is quite popular these days and i want to publish some code in this blog, ive written this little guide for helping me to remember. Postman crossplatform rest client, available for mac, windows, and linux. Where it fails to impress, browser addons often pick up the slack. But those things are only great after youve pushed your code to github. You should then contact your new isp and inform them of the mac, they will then be able to process your request to move your broadband service. It will push to heroku and give you a url that your own private requestbin will be running. Based on the original work of haakonnessjoen hakon nessjoen. Oct 31, 2018 rce cornucopia is a series of remote code execution challenges created by dejan zelic for the ctf at appsec usa 2018. Github desktop focus on what matters instead of fighting with git. The world of electronics is completely foreign for most developers.
We have discontinued the publicly hosted version of requestbin due to ongoing abuse that made it very difficult to keep the site up reliably. There are a few ways to host your own linux server. Is git bash for osx a good substitute for the standard mac. If you also have the repository stored on github you can of course sync between the two. The rootendpoint of githubs api is while the rootendpoint twitters api is the path determines the resource youre requesting for. We see a space, the browser sends a %20 the hostname poc worked.
They are basically a folder with a shortcut to the applications directory but they can be customized with icons, backgrounds, and layout properties. Popular alternatives to for web, windows, mac, linux, software as a service saas and more. Contribute to sb2novmac setup development by creating an account on github. Sep 01, 2011 despite the fact that all network devices laptops, iphones, routers, etc. Webhooks are configured at the app level under the settings page of your specified app. First of all, note that ive said newbie guide and not guide for newbies. Heres addons plus a few honorable mentions that will take your github experience to the next level. Announcing spoofmac spoof your mac address in mac os x. While the steps below should still work, i recommend checking out the new guide if you are running 10. Sep 07, 2016 unity cloud build is a continuous integration service for games and apps built in unity. By downloading, you agree to the open source applications terms. Js hardware getting started with nodebots and johnny. Github git os x mac as a developer, you probably use git and github all the time. Github desktop allows developers to synchronize branches, clone repositories, and more.
Knowing how to use git is incredibly important for all developers, whether youre building a simple htmlcss website or making your own operating system. My goal with this post is to list out all the api tools that i know of and frequently recommend to people. Create a heroku account if you havent, then grab the requestbin source using git. This is the first hop from the server back to the client. Mac os x internals tasks explorer application tasks explorer was designed as alternative to apples activity monitor, as information providing activity monitor does not correspond with the needs of software developers and advanced users. How to use github for mac with local git repo stack overflow. Jun 23, 2011 yesterday github for mac was announced by the good folks over at github. Github is a desktop client for creating software on the increasingly popular. In this short tutorial, well make sure thats all set up correctly, and walk you through how to connect the two together on your mac. Mar 29, 2018 requestbin lets you create a webhooks url and send data to it to see how its recognized.
To fully learn git, youll need to set up both git and github on your mac. More than 40 million people use github to discover, fork, and contribute to over 100 million projects. I formatted it in a way that made it easier for folks who were less familiar with the ins and outs of the terminal and all of the snags you inevitably. Github is an amazing set of tools around git, but its lacking in certain areas. Webhooks and slack notifications in unity cloud build unity. Mirror a github project to gitlab github2gitlab is a command line tool to mirror the git repository and the pull requests of a github project to gitlab. This letter will be posted out within 2 working days. So far, the tools for working with api requests live on the command line. It was designed by apple and is meant specifically for their hardware. The result will by something like b240ac4fffe008d88 where 240ac4fffe008d88 is your gateway id to be used in your network provider configuration main main. Integration into the pull request workflow would be fantastic. Its a good test command because its likely to be on the system and in the path, the name only contains alpha. Understanding and using rest apis smashing magazine. Azure devops unlimited private repos git and tfs for up to 5 usersteam.
Both are long youve been programming, and what tools youve installed, you may already have git on your computer. The best tools for working with api requests the zapier. Yesterday github for mac was announced by the good folks over at github. To create the public key run through the github instructions on providing an ssh key for os x, or use mine.
Unity cloud build makes it simple and easy to create and share builds of your game, letting you and your team iterate faster and always be on the same page. It shows my outgoing changes, but then i appear to have to push to the server, and there appears to be no way to perform a sync without publishing to github which we dont want to do. We use github, but bitbucket and gitlab also provide this workflow really well and this would make testing so much easier. Now, serialize some data in form encoded styleor copy our example form copy above. Whether youre new to git or a seasoned user, github desktop simplifies your development workflow. Ive been using subversion for years but i knew nothing about git. I was disappointed with the mac os x offering in this. Jan 15, 2012 newbie guide for using github in mac osx. We currently only support webhooks for slack and microsoft teams. Download for macos download for windows 64bit download for macos or windows msi download for windows. Set the remote manually in the settings tab and everything else should work as expected. Webhooks and slack notifications in unity cloud build.
First thing to do, is to create the group in the server for. For github, the ideal integration would be an automatic build on a pr and then report back using the github status api to inform github about the outcome. This github action builds and uploads go build artifacts as release artifacts automatically when release was created on github repository. There are already plenty of guides that explain the particular steps of getting git and github going on your mac in detail. Last year i wrote a post that went through the process of setting up a mac with a fresh version of git and authenticating with github. Before we can begin using git, we first need to install it. Think of it like an automatic answering machine that asks you to press 1 for a service, press 2 for another service, 3 for yet another service and so on. There is an updated version of this post for os x 10. Saturday i installed github desktop on my mac and tried the github workflow.
Github for mac is optimized to work with github remotes but if you wish to use a nongithub remote, it will work just fine. Using git version control for code projects creating a new code repo from a local working copy with the github for mac app. Requestbin gives you a url that will collect requests made to it and let you inspect. Explore 10 websites and apps like, all suggested and ranked by the alternativeto user community. I thought id setup a local project in visual studio for mac and then turn the clock back a bit to see if maybe how the code was implemented changed between. We could go out to the homepage of the git open sourceproject, and wed find installer files there for both mac, and windows,but a much easier way to install it is through the installationof the github client, which is also available for both mac and windows. From the repositories view in the app, drag the project folder to the bottom of the left sidebar. Mar 16, 2020 installing development environment on macos. Posted on july 28, 2015 by khanh installations made simple. Users must have have manager or developer permissions in the app to be able to create and configure the webhooks. For any challenge i like to observe the normal functionality of the application before trying anything funky. A dmg installer is convenient way to provide endusers a simple way to install an application bundle. Jan 29, 2020 it will push to heroku and give you a url that your own private requestbin will be running.
If youre after both a translator and a guide for your journey, though, consider the webbased hurl. Whatll happen is youll get the clients ip address, try to resolve it to a mac using arp, but then youll find that the mac you get back is the same for just about all of your clients depending on network layout and its the mac for the routers nearside interface. If you prefer to build from source, you can find tarballs on. Js hardware getting started with nodebots and johnnyfive getting started with hardware hacking can be quite intimidating for some folks. This means you can manage local git repositories stored on your mac using the same familiar features on github. If you also have the repository stored on github you can of course.
Requestbin generates a url you can send gitlab webhook requests to. Requestbin lets you create a webhooks url and send data to it to see how its recognized. Newbie guide for using github in mac osx ivans blog. Go to requestbin, click create a requestbin, then copy the url it gives you. Learn more about the rest api checking the official wordpress rest api documentation. All contributors will have ssh access to the server. Today i installed github for mac at work and the pull request button is no where to be found. Deployment information and solutions from the author are available here. Pretty much every day someone asks me if theres a tool for solving a specific api problem.
Im back home now on my private mac and the button is missing here as well now. The request library is available from maven central. Deploy your own instance using docker on the servermachine you want to host this, youll first need a machine with docker and dockercompose installed, then grab the requestbin source using git. Pull requests, merge button, fork queue, issues, pages, wiki. This was run by runscope at the time and the source code is still up on github runscoperequestbin. While runscope solves many api problems particularly debugging, testing and monitoring for app developers, there are many things we dont do. Gnu bash from the gnu distribution site is up to version 4. Once configuration is set, the nanogateway is then started. Created a branch, committed changes and did a pull request. Github desktop simple collaboration from your desktop. Some basic git instructions for github for mac and the. On successful submission of the form we will post the mac to your manx telecom billing address for the telephone or fibre number you enter. App center webhooks documentation visual studio app center.
This setup is maybe the simplier one, and it is suitable for very few contributors. Js hardware getting started with nodebots and johnnyfive. I formatted it in a way that made it easier for folks who were less familiar with the ins and outs of the terminal and. The browsers address bar is a convenient place to do this sort of challenge because it displays normal ascii to us but sends requests with the appropriate url encoding. Insomnia crossplatform graphql and rest client, available for mac, windows, and linux. In order to access github you will need to create a public key on your machine and add it to the account.
1117 998 981 171 686 915 598 408 331 343 1459 1234 1226 631 1286 727 1201 1362 1286 68 1500 533 1102 413 1495 1649 552 680 302 1521 1355 305 845 159 1200 623 226 17 746 668 193